Scenic Hot Springs Conditions, April 5th, 2007
Conditions: Clear, sunny skies, 50F @ Pools; 68F on the Upper BPA Road. Snow is still 2-4 ft deep, wet & heavy. Melt is accelerating. Snowshoes are not required as snow will support boots. Some icy areas under shade. Spring Source East #1 (Lobster Upper): 96.1F, Flow: 15.35 gpm (measured) East #2 (Lobster Lower): 68.8F, disconnected from feed tube Feed was back in place supplying the pool.

Scenic Hot Springs Conditions, March 26th, 2007
In a nutshell, the snow is melting but there is still plenty of it. FS850 is undriveble with unstable snowpack from three to six feet. Erosion on the slopes is typical for the spring melt, with a few new wrinkles but no major sliding. Snowshoes are still advised but they will go on and off, as there are plenty of bare patches.
